Configuration of MongoTopCollTest For each database on the server, the test reports the rate at which operations such as querying, inserting, updating, deleting, etc., are performed on that database. This points to busy databases and what is keeping them busy! Additionally, the test reveals where the database spent most of its time - query execution? updation? insertion? command execution? Detailed diagnostics of the test also point you to the exact collection in a database that prolonged each of these operations, thus enabling administrators to swoop down on problem collections. Furthermore, the test focuses on the locking activity in each database. The rate, type, and duration of locks held are reported, and administrators proactively alerted to locking-related irregularities. In the event of an alert, you can use the detailed diagnostics of the test to identify which collections hold the maximum locks and which ones have held locks for the maximum time.
